Tarte tatin

tartetatin 02 Gourmandise School of Sweets and Savories

Layer sliced apples in melted, caramelized sugar

tartetatin 03 Gourmandise School of Sweets and Savories

Caramelize the apples

TARTETATIN 04 Gourmandise School of Sweets and Savories

Roll out pastry dough, place it atop of the apples, then bake, flip, and consume
